  • Master Lock 107DSPT Gun Lock ($10.26)— My experience with guns is limited to shooting at clay pigeons on a ranch in Montana but I do know that if you own guns and you have kids or there is the remote possibility that someone may pick up the gun in your home and try it, that it needs to be locked up. If you’re not ready to invest in a gun safe, I suppose this Cable Gun Lock might be a good solution for you. Just make sure that it is locked around something stationary and the key is hidden to prevent a tragic accident.
  • Master Lock 265DCCSEN Door Security Bar ($26.73)— If you feel like your door or sliding patio door could be a bit more secure, the Adjustable Door Security Bar can provide that comfort since it adjusts from 27 ½” – 42” and works to prevent forced entry.
